Abstract

The utility model discloses an air conditioner air inlet for filtering incoming air, which comprises an air pipe connected to the air conditioner air inlet, wherein a filter plate is arranged in the air pipe, the front two sides of the filter plate are respectively attached to a first baffle strip and a second baffle strip, the first baffle strip and the second baffle strip are fixedly connected in the air pipe, the top surface of the air pipe is vertically fixed with a second electric push rod, the output end of the second electric push rod penetrates through the air pipe in a sliding manner and extends to the inside, the tail end of the second electric push rod is fixedly connected with a pressing plate attached to the top surface of the filter plate, the top wall of the air pipe is provided with a groove, the two sides of the air pipe are respectively communicated with a storage box and a recovery box, and the push plate is connected in a sliding manner in the storage box. According to the utility model, the first barrier strip, the second barrier strip, the first electric push rod and the pressing plate are arranged in the air pipe, so that the filter plate is fixed, the filter plate is prevented from falling off from the air pipe when being replaced, and meanwhile, the filter plate is prevented from shaking under the action of wind force when the air is filtered.

Air conditioner air inlet for filtering inlet air
Technical Field
The utility model relates to the technical field of air conditioners, in particular to an air conditioner air inlet for filtering inlet air.
Background
The central air conditioner air inlet refers to an air inlet for returning indoor polluted air, and a filtering device is generally arranged in the air inlet so as to facilitate the air conditioner indoor unit to filter the polluted air, and the polluted air is heated or cooled and then blown into the room again to form air circulation. Therefore, the selection of the filtering device is very important, and the filtering device can ensure the safety and comfort of indoor air.
Patent publication number CN212157618U discloses a central air conditioning air intake filter equipment, includes: the working cavity of the filter plate is fixedly connected with the air inlet of the central air conditioner; the filter plate storage cavity is provided with two electric push rods which are vertically arranged, one side of the filter plate storage cavity is provided with a feeding door, and the filter plate storage cavity is fixedly connected with the filter plate working cavity; the filter plate abandoned cavity is provided with a turnover boss, is fixedly connected with the other side of the filter plate working cavity and is correspondingly arranged with the filter plate storage cavity; the filter plate working cavity, the filter plate storage cavity and the filter plate abandoned cavity are respectively provided with a filter plate groove. Therefore, the utility model adds the air filtering device at the air inlet of the air conditioner, automatically replaces the filter plate, automatically overturns and falls off on the overturning boss by gravity after replacement, and prepares for the replacement of the filter plate next time, and has simple structure, easy maintenance and low cost.
However, when a new filter plate is pushed into the working cavity of the filter plate, the filter plate is easy to deviate in the pushing process and even can fall off from the working cavity of the filter plate due to the fact that a limiting component is not arranged in the working cavity of the filter plate.

Referring to fig. 1 to 5, the present utility model provides an air inlet of an air conditioner for filtering intake air: the automatic feeding device comprises an air pipe 1 connected to an air inlet of an air conditioner, wherein a filter plate 6 is arranged in the air pipe 1, the front two sides of the filter plate 6 are respectively attached to a first barrier strip 4 and a second barrier strip 14, the first barrier strip 4 and the second barrier strip 14 are fixedly connected in the air pipe 1, the top surface of the air pipe 1 is vertically fixed with a second electric push rod 8, the output end of the second electric push rod 8 penetrates through the air pipe 1 in a sliding manner and extends into the air pipe, the tail end of the second electric push rod 8 is fixedly connected with a pressing plate 15 attached to the top surface of the filter plate 6, the top wall of the air pipe 1 is provided with a groove 16, the two sides of the air pipe 1 are respectively communicated with a storage box 2 and a recovery box 5, the side surface of the recovery box 5 penetrates through a material taking opening 10, the material taking opening 10 is in a sliding manner and is connected with a drawer 9, the storage box 2 is in a sliding manner and is connected with a push plate 11 in a sliding manner, the upper inner wall and the lower inner wall of the storage box 2 is provided with a sliding groove 13, the sliding groove 13 is connected with the push plate 11 in a sliding manner, the sliding plate 17 is connected with the sliding plate 17 in a abutting spring 18 between the sliding groove 13 and the sliding plate 17;
the first barrier strip 4, the second barrier strip 14, the first electric push rod 3 and the pressing plate 15 are arranged in the air pipe 1, so that the filter plate 6 is fixed, the filter plate is prevented from falling off from the air pipe 1 when being replaced, and meanwhile, the filter plate 6 is prevented from shaking under the action of wind force when the air is filtered;
the bottom wall of the storage box 2 is provided with a guide groove 12, a U-shaped plate 22 is connected in a sliding manner in the guide groove 12, a push block 19 is hinged in the U-shaped plate 22, a torsion spring 21 is arranged at the hinge joint of the U-shaped plate 22 and the push block 19, the right side of the push block 19 is fixedly connected with a limiting block 20 attached to the top surface of the U-shaped plate 22, the side surface of the storage box 2 is horizontally fixed with a first electric push rod 3 connected with the U-shaped plate 22, the U-shaped plate 22 is horizontally arranged in the guide groove 12, and an opening of the U-shaped plate 22 is positioned at one side of the air pipe 1;
by arranging the first electric push rod 3, the U-shaped plate 22, the push block 19 and the guide groove 12, the filter plate 6 can be automatically replaced conveniently without manual replacement;
the top surface of the recovery tank 5 is fixedly connected with a water tank 7, a water pump is arranged in the water tank 7, the output end of the water pump is connected with a water pipe, the water pipe penetrates through the water tank 7 and extends into the recovery tank 5, the top surface of the recovery tank 5 is fixedly connected with a hollow plate communicated with the water pipe, and the bottom surface of the hollow plate is vertically communicated with a plurality of spray heads distributed at equal intervals;
by arranging the spray head in the recovery box 5, the dust on the old filter plate 6 is prevented from drifting everywhere due to the impact force generated when falling into the recovery box 5, and the dust on the old filter plate 6 is reduced;
working principle: the new filter plates 6 are sequentially placed in the storage box and positioned by the push plate 11, when the filter plates 6 need to be replaced, the second electric push rod 8 drives the pressing plate 15 to ascend, so that the pressing plate 15 is contained in the groove 16, then the first electric push rod 3 pushes the U-shaped plate 22, the push block 19 on the U-shaped plate 22 pushes the new filter plates 6 into the air duct 1, when the new filter plates 6 enter the air duct 1, the new filter plates 6 push the old filter plates 6 into the recovery box 5, when the old filter plates 6 enter the recovery box 5, the old filter plates are turned downwards by the gravity of the old filter plates and fall into the drawer 9, meanwhile, the water pump pumps out water in the water tank 7, the water pipe is sent into the hollow plate, dust on the old filter plates 6 is subjected to dust fall treatment by being sprayed out by a spray head below the hollow plate, the dust is prevented from drifting around, when the new filter plates 6 enter the air duct 1, the second electric push rod 8 drives the pressing plate 15 to descend, the pressing plate 15 presses the top surface of the filter plate 6 to fix, when the new filter plate 6 moves into the air pipe 1, the next new filter plate 6 moves towards the front wall of the storage box 2 under the action of the push plate 11 and the springs 18, and is attached to the front wall, when the installation of the new filter plate 6 is completed, the first electric push rod 3 drives the U-shaped plate 22 to move towards the right side, when the push block 19 is attached to the outer side of the filter plate 6 in the storage box 2, the push block 19 is turned downwards under the extrusion of the filter plate 6, so that the push block 19 is retracted into the guide groove 12, when the push block 19 is turned, the torsion spring 21 is stressed to compress, when the push block 19 moves to the rightmost side, the push block 19 is separated from the filter plate 6, the torsion spring 21 in the compressed state drives the push block 19 to turn upwards when resetting, so that the limiting block 20 is attached to the top surface of the U-shaped plate 22, and the replacement of the air conditioner filter plate 6 is completed.
